Performance in Use
The LIP-8024E is the handset you put on the busiest desks in the building. With 24 programmable buttons and tri-colour LEDs, a receptionist can see at a glance which lines are ringing, which colleagues are on a call, and which are free — transferring and managing multiple callers without hunting through menus. The 4-line backlit LCD keeps caller and call information clearly in view even under office lighting, and wideband codecs (G.711, G.722, G.723, G.729) deliver crisp, professional voice quality.
For managers and power users, the context-sensitive soft keys put the right options within reach at each step of a call, while the full-duplex speakerphone with automatic gain control keeps hands-free conversations clear. Dual Gigabit Ethernet ports mean the phone and a desktop PC share one network drop without throttling the connection — a genuine advantage of the "E" Gigabit model over 10/100 handsets. When even 24 buttons aren't enough, DSS/LSS expansion modules clip on to add banks of extra keys.
Deployment is straightforward: the handset draws power over Ethernet and self-configures on connection to your iPECS platform, so it registers from a single PoE switch port with minimal setup. As part of the LG-Ericsson iPECS 8000-series range, it integrates cleanly with iPECS call servers and other 8000-series handsets for a consistent experience across the fleet.

Frequently Asked Questions
Does this phone work on its own?
No — the LIP-8024E is a system handset that registers to an LG-Ericsson iPECS call server. It is ideal for adding to or replacing handsets on an existing iPECS platform.
What makes the "E" model different from the "D"?
The LIP-8024E has dual Gigabit Ethernet ports (10/100/1000), whereas the 8024D runs 10/100. If you want the phone's PC pass-through port to run at full Gigabit speed, the "E" is the model to choose.
Is it powered over Ethernet?
Yes. It supports 802.3af PoE Class 2, so a single cable carries both data and power from your switch. A compatible power adapter can be used if you don't have PoE.
Can I add more buttons?
Yes. It supports DSS/LSS expansion modules adding 12, 40, or 48 extra programmable buttons for high-volume reception roles.
